    What is the 11° north parallel in Thailand?
    In Thailand, a 1966 cabinet resolution restricts the rights of non-Thai companies to conduct mineral exploration or mining operations north of this parallel.         The Massacre at 11th Parallel occurred in 1963, when men hired by a rubber company killed 3500 members of the indigenous Amazon group, Cinta Larga and destroyed their village. Only two villagers survived. The massacre was a part of the larger, …
